smock
countable noun: A smock is a loose garment, rather like a long blouse, usually worn by women.

smock in American English
a loose, shirtlike outer garment worn to protect the clothes
to dress in a smock
noun: a loose, lightweight overgarment worn to protect the clothing while working
transitive verb: to clothe in a smock

smock in British English
noun: any loose protective garment, worn by artists, laboratory technicians, etc
verb: to ornament (a garment) with smocking
